Embarking on Your Bearing Press Odyssey

Before embarking on your bearing press adventure, it's essential to understand the fundamentals of this powerful tool. A bearing press is essentially a machine that applies controlled force to press two pieces of metal together. This force is typically measured in tons, with the most common models in the Harbor Freight line ranging from 12 to 20 tons.

Types of Bearing Presses

Harbor Freight offers an array of bearing presses, each tailored to specific applications. The manual press is the most basic and affordable option, relying on human effort to generate force. Hydraulic presses employ a hydraulic cylinder to deliver precise and consistent force, making them suitable for heavier tasks. Electric presses offer the ultimate convenience, using an electric motor to power the pressing operation.

Choosing the Right Press for Your Needs

Selecting the ideal Harbor Freight bearing press hinges on the following factors:

  • Tonnage: The tonnage rating determines the maximum force the press can exert. Choose a press with a tonnage capacity suited to your specific requirements.
  • Stroke: The stroke length indicates the maximum distance the ram can travel. Ensure the press has adequate stroke length for your intended uses.
  • Pressing Surface: The pressing surface determines the size and shape of the components you can press. Select a press with a pressing surface that accommodates your workpiece dimensions.
  • Height: The overall height of the press is often determined by the stroke length and the clearance needed for loading and unloading workpieces. Consider the available space in your work area.

Illuminating the Path: A Comprehensive Guide to Operation

Proper operation of a Harbor Freight bearing press is crucial for ensuring safety and optimal performance. Follow these steps for successful pressing operations:

  1. Prepare the Workpiece: Position the workpiece on the press bed, ensuring it is aligned and stable.
  2. Select the Correct Die: Choose the appropriate die for the bearing or component being pressed. Install the die on the ram and secure it firmly.
  3. Set the Force: Determine the required force based on the application and the workpiece material. Set the force dial to the desired setting.
  4. Engage the Press: Gradually engage the press by actuating the operating lever or button. Monitor the force gauge to ensure it reaches the desired level.
  5. Press the Workpiece: Slowly and carefully press the workpiece until the desired result is achieved. Release the press when complete.
  6. Unload the Workpiece: Carefully remove the pressed workpiece from the press bed.

Embracing Safety: A Paramount Priority

Safety should be your paramount concern when operating a Harbor Freight bearing press. Follow these guidelines to minimize risks:

  • Wear appropriate safety gear, including eye protection, gloves, and hearing protection.
  • Ensure the press is properly anchored to a solid surface.
  • Never exceed the press's maximum rated tonnage.
  • Keep hands and fingers away from the press's moving parts.
  • Never leave the press unattended while it is operating.
  • Inspect the press regularly for any signs of wear or damage.
